  • The AI in Genomics Market is valued at USD 1.21 billion in 2024.
  • The AI in Genomics Market will achieve USD 58.62 billion by 2035 through a projected 42.3% CAGR from 2025 to 2035.
  • The four primary drivers in the adoption of AI in genomics include the increase in investments in precision medicine, the expansion of genomics databases, the increased need for detecting diseases at earlier stages, and the growing sophistication of genomic data. The success of deep learning and neural networks in neural networks and natural language processing makes it possible to interpret genomic data in real time, which can be used to support the individual approach to treatment.
  • The AI in Genomics market is divided into software, hardware, and services as the segments based on offering. Software solutions delivered by AI are the most popular on the market since they are the most scalable and can handle huge amounts of data, whereas services like consulting and integration are becoming more prevalent to assist in covering the entire process of AI implementation in research and clinical environments.
  • The market includes machine learning, deep learning, and natural language processing, all by technologies. Deep learning, in particular, is widely used in the identification of rare genetic variants and risk prediction analysis. In the Functionality clause, AI promotes gene expression analysis, genome sequencing, variant calling, and clinical diagnosis, and through this, scientists and clinicians can run an automated drug discovery and development pathway.
  • This market is segmented based on end-users because pharmaceutical and biotech companies, healthcare providers, academic & research institutes, and government organizations represent a major part of the market. The education organization and research centers use AI to discover new associations between genes and diseases, and pharmaceutical companies use AI to discover biomarkers and stratify patients.
  • Leading players in the change of this market are referred to as IBM, Microsoft, NVIDIA, and Deep Genomics. These technology leaders and genomics pioneers disrupt the market with the strategy of valuable partnerships, platforms using AI, and high-throughput computing skills.
  • Geographically, the AI in Genomics market covers North America, Europe, Asia Pacific, Latin America, the Middle East, and Africa. The U.S. controls the global market due to the availability of strong AI infrastructure, the availability of funding for genomics research, and extensive genomic data collection. Asia Pacific, on the other hand, is experiencing drastic development due to the government-driven genomics programs and the growing AI investments in states such as China and India.
  • AI adoption in genomics is a paradigm shift in the field of healthcare, which leads to personalized, predictive, and preventive medicine. As the world of data-driven advances keeps on developing, the market will serve as one of the foundations of the health care revolution of the future.
